Jim Pate is a retired librarian, having worked at the Birmingham Public Library for many years. He is also a part time legal assistant and researcher.

Pate's hobbies include competing in official Scrabble crossword game tournaments, making boomerangs, and constructing and playing Caribbean steel drums. He was the Alabama State Scrabble Champion in 2002. He also served on the Dictionary Committee of the North American Scrabble Players Association for many years and acted as the committee's chair from 2009 to 2014.

Pate identifies himself as a Christian.
